Etymology

edit

From me(thyl) +‎ pi(pecoloxylidide) +‎ -vacaine (alteration of Novocaine).

Noun

edit

mepivacaine (uncountable)

  1. (pharmacology) A local anesthetic derived from piperidine and similar in structure and action to lidocaine, usually given by injection as the hydrochloride; (1-methyl-2-piperidyl)formo-2′,6′-xylidide, C15H22N2O.
